In simple terms, it refers to the microscopic irregularities on the surface of a material. You can&#8217;t see these with the naked eye, but they can have a huge impact on how the material behaves. With medical titanium rods, surface roughness can affect everything from how well the rod integrates with the surrounding tissue to its resistance to wear and tear.<\/p>\n<p>So, why is surface roughness so important in medical titanium rods? Well, when you&#8217;re dealing with medical devices that are going to be implanted in the human body, you need to make sure they work as well as possible. For medical titanium rods, a certain level of surface roughness can promote better osseointegration. That&#8217;s a fancy term for when the bone tissue grows and attaches to the surface of the implant. When the surface has the right kind of roughness, it provides more area for the bone cells to cling to, which helps the implant stay firmly in place.<\/p>\n<p>Now, let&#8217;s get into the details of the ideal surface roughness for medical titanium rods. There&#8217;s no one-size-fits-all answer here because it depends on the specific application of the rod. For example, if the rod is used in orthopedic surgeries for fixing fractures, a slightly rougher surface might be preferred. A roughness in the range of 1 &#8211; 5 micrometers (\u03bcm) can be beneficial. This rough surface mimics the natural texture of bone, which signals the body&#8217;s cells to start growing around it. On the other hand, if the rod is used in a more delicate procedure, like in dental implants, a smoother surface might be needed. In this case, a roughness of around 0.1 &#8211; 1 \u03bcm could be more suitable. This smoother surface can reduce the risk of irritation to the surrounding soft tissues.<\/p>\n<p>But how do we control the surface roughness of medical titanium rods? Well, there are several methods. One common way is through mechanical processing. This can include machining operations like grinding and sandblasting. Grinding uses an abrasive wheel to remove small amounts of material from the surface, creating a more controlled roughness. Sandblasting, on the other hand, shoots tiny particles at high speed onto the surface of the rod, which can create a more irregular and porous texture.<\/p>\n<p>Another method is chemical treatment. We can use certain chemicals to etch the surface of the titanium rod. This process selectively removes material from the surface, leaving behind a rougher finish. By carefully controlling the concentration of the chemicals and the duration of the treatment, we can achieve the desired level of surface roughness.<\/p>\n<p>As a supplier of medical titanium rods, I understand the importance of getting the surface roughness just right.
